Official title Efficacy and Safety of Additive Manufacturing Personalized Titanium Mesh in Guided Bone Regeneration

ClinicalTrials.gov ID: NCT06692244

What this study is testing

What it's testing
This goal of this single-blind, simple randomized, positive-controlled prospective study is to evaluate the effects of additive-manufactured personalized titanium mesh and traditional titanium mesh in guided bone regeneration for large alveolar bone defects. The study will assess the short-term and long-term efficacy, safety, and incidence of complications of the additive-manufactured personalized titanium mesh, along with an analysis of risk factors.

Who can join
  • Patients missing single or multiple teeth with moderate to severe bone defects in the edentulous area requiring complex guided bone regeneration. (Moderate bone defects: bone loss with residual alveolar ridge width...
  • The edge of the edentulous area within 1 mm is alveolar bone, with no adjacent tooth roots or nerve canals, ensuring complete retention of the personalized titanium mesh edge. The apical edge of the edentulous area...
  • The patient and/or his/her guardian agrees to participate in this trial and signs the informed consent form.
What rules you out
  • Patients with edentulism.
  • Patients with mild bone defects (residual alveolar ridge width greater than 3 mm).
  • Presence of acute or chronic infection in the surgical area.
  • Presence of acute or chronic infection in the teeth adjacent to the edentulous area.
  • Participation in similar trials or other treatment clinical trials within 30 days prior to signing the informed consent form.
  • History of metal allergies, severe allergy history, or severe immune deficiency.
  • Uncontrolled metabolic diseases, such as Type 1 diabetes or Type 2 diabetes (HbA1c ≥ 7% or fasting blood glucose ≥ 7 mmol/L despite medication control), severe liver or kidney dysfunction (ALT, AST \> 2 times the upper...
  • Long-term use of steroid medications.
  • History of drug abuse or alcoholism.
  • Pregnant or breastfeeding women.
  • Poor compliance.
  • Other conditions deemed unsuitable for participation by the investigator.
